What creates a magnetic field? Magnetic fields are produced by moving charged particles. Even the magnet on your fridge is magnetic because it containselectronsthat are constantly moving around. Magnetic fields are created from electrically charged gases generating electrical currents that act as a magnetic dynamo inside the sun, according to astatement from NASA.
